N052041 February 18, 2009 CLA-2-61:OT:RR:NC:3:358 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 6101.20.0020 Ms. Tonya Talleur Nike, Inc. One Bowerman Drive Beaverton, Oregon 97005-6453 RE: The tariff classification of boys’ jackets from China. Dear Ms. Talleur: In your letter dated February 12, 2009, you requested a tariff classification ruling. Four samples were submitted with your request. The articles will be returned to you. Style 347770 is described as a Boy’s All Over Print Hoody. The jacket has a hood, a full front opening with zipper closure, long set-in sleeves with rib-knit cuffs, patch pockets with side scoop openings and a rib-knit bottom. The item has a whimsical all-over print design. The article is constructed of finely knit 79% cotton, 21% polyester fabric that is napped on the inside. The hood is lined with contrast color jersey fabric. Style 341700 is described as a Boy’s Full Zip Corp Fleece. The jacket has a hood, a full front opening with zipper closure, long set-in sleeves with rib-knit cuffs, patch pockets with side scoop openings and a rib-knit bottom. The name Nike ™ appears as contrast color appliqué work on the garment front. There are two oversize letters on each side of upper body. The article is constructed of finely knit 79% cotton, 21% polyester fabric that is napped on the inside. The hood is lined with jersey fabric. Style 341645 is described as a Boy’s Slam Dunk Full Zip Hoody. The jacket has a hood, a full front opening with zipper closure, long set-in sleeves with rib-knit cuffs, pieced pockets with side scoop openings and a rib-knit bottom. The item has a basketball motif all-over print design. The Nike ™ swoosh appears as contrast color embroidery on the garment front. A contrast color appliqué with embroidery depicting a basketball appears on the upper portion of one sleeve. The article is constructed of finely knit 80% cotton, 20% polyester fabric that is napped on the inside. The hood is lined with satin fabric. Style 341826 is described as a Boy’s Traction Fleece. The jacket has a hood, a full front opening with zipper closure, long raglan sleeves with partial rib-knit cuffs, set-in pockets with side scoop openings and a partial rib-knit bottom. The item has a solid color body except for contrast color woven overlays at the shoulders. The name Nike ™ appears as contrast color print designs on one side of the front upper body and down the length of one sleeve. The article is constructed of finely knit 80% cotton, 20% polyester fabric that is napped on the inside. The hood is lined with the same woven shoulder fabric. The applicable subheading for styles 347770, 341700, 341645 and 341826 will be 6101.20.0020,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TSUS), which provides for men’s or boys’ overcoats, carcoats, capes, cloaks, anoraks, wind-breakers, and similar articles, knitted or crocheted, other than those of heading 6103, of cotton, boys’. The rate of duty will be 15.9 percent ad valorem. Duty rates are provided for your convenience and are subject to change.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). A copy of the ruling or the control number indicated above should be provided with the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ported.
